## v2.14.0 — Digest Scheduling

Added batch email digest scheduling to Lanternpost. Digests now queue per-tenant on a cron-like spec stored in `digest_rules`. Backfill for existing tenants ran Tuesday; defaults are daily at 06:00 tenant-local. Retry policy: three attempts, exponential backoff, then dead-letter. New hires: do not edit `digest_rules` directly — use the admin panel. Flag `digest_v2` must stay on in staging. For questions or rollbacks, contact the engineer who owns this feature.

account owner for kafop-haweg: Pelax Gilael Istir

Quarterly Planning Note — Divestiture of the Coastal Tooling Unit

For the finance team: the sale of the Coastal Tooling unit to Pellmark Industries remains on track for close in Q3. Please finalize the carve-out balance sheet, reconcile intercompany positions, and prepare the working-capital adjustment schedule by month-end. Audit support requests should be prioritized. For planning purposes, note the following sensitive item:

internal memo for hawef-kahif: The finance team signed off on a budget of $25.9 million for Project Sorox. The renewal with Pelokek Logistics closes at $51.7 million a year, 52 percent below the last contract.

Ticket: load test the Pebblecart checkout flow before the Harvestfest promo. Plan is 5x normal traffic against staging, focus on the payment-intent step that fell over last time. Scripts are ready in the Loadlark repo; just need a green light to run them Thursday night. Sign-off needed from the engineer named below.

account owner for bawip-tahag: Raleth Quenok

// RESET_TOKEN_TTL_MINUTES governs the password reset flow revamped in the
// Larkspur project. Before you change this: the token lifetime is coupled to
// the email queue retry window in Mailwren, so shortening it below 15 minutes
// will cause delayed emails to arrive with already-expired links. The old flow
// hashed tokens with a per-user salt; the new one uses a rotating pepper, so
// old tokens are invalid after deploy by design. The value below was validated
// against the build recorded here.

build token for yajof-bajof: htk31_506ff1188f74596b5bb2eec94edc43c